Where the waste is hiding

Gloves control the discussion because they dominate the bin. In industries like food processing, automobile, biotech, and electronic devices setting up, PPE gloves are transformed often for good reason. Oils, powders, and tiny particles do actual damages. On a line producing sterile parts, a single particle can ditch a batch. Raw counts differ extensively by industry, however I often see glove change rates of one to three sets per hour per driver. Multiply by changes and head count, and it's common to strike six to 8 numbers in yearly handwear cover intake across a multi-site organization.

Other PPE, from sleeves and bouffants to masks and boot covers, add also. Yet industrial glove recycling handwear covers offer the most regular stream with the tightest specs, making PPE gloves recycling the logical entry point. They have predictable polymers, high quantities, and fairly low mass each, which, strangely sufficient, makes logistics both simpler and more difficult. Easier because the product is uniform, trickier because the sheer variety of products suggests any little ineffectiveness multiplies.

The waste is not just physical. It beings in purchase premiums for virgin materials, fees for disposal, and concealed labor prices around regular restocking and container handling. If you're tracking Ecological duty metrics, there's additionally the upstream footprint linked to producing numerous small plastic items that see mins of use. A round economic situation version does not eliminate these influences, yet it can flex the curve.

Safety, then circularity

The first rule is nonnegotiable: safety and product honesty come first. Cross-contamination avoidance lives at the core of any kind of severe PPE program. If the cleaning or reusing loophole introduces real risk, the program will certainly never scale, nor must it. The trick is to match material moves to risk tiers, and to deal with each website as a distinct puzzle.

In food and pharma, a single glove thrown out in a raw zone can not combine with one from a high-care zone. In electronic devices setting up, a glove that got conductive particles presents a different threat account than one utilized for product packaging. In labs, organic or chemical exposure can disqualify entire streams from recycling. That's why effective programs begin with a segregation map, not an advertising and marketing motto. You define streams by what they touched, not by what they are made of.

I have actually seen plants try a one-bin-fits-all technique and abandon it within months. The much better course utilizes color-coded, clearly identified containers and basic, aesthetic common work. Operators has to be able to make the best selection in 2 seconds. The point is not perfection. It is constructing a system that catches 90 percent of recoverable product without trapping people in decision paralysis. Begin with one or two streams where danger is reduced and quantity is high, then expand.

Cleaning, recycling, or both

There are 2 key ways to maintain handwear covers in a loophole: handwear cover cleaning for reuse and products reusing. They aren't compatible. They fix different problems for different environments.

Glove cleaning, which may consist of washing, drying out, and verified quality checks, helps durable handwear covers, cut-resistant gloves, or specialized handwear covers created for numerous usages. Think of nitrile-coated work handwear covers in auto subassembly or thicker chemical-resistant handwear covers in upkeep areas. The method is not about sending out slim non reusable handwear covers via a laundry, it has to do with expanding the life of handwear covers constructed for it. With tight validation, you can push service life from, say, one week to 3 or 4, while keeping hold, tensile toughness, and cleanliness requirements. That demands a robust assessment procedure. Glove cleansing, when done by a competent supplier, can additionally include traceable sets, so you can draw a lot if there's an issue.

Materials reusing, on the other hand, handles high quantities of single-use nitrile or latex. These gloves are unclean for reuse available. They are gathered, validated non-hazardous, and refined right into additional products. Regular results consist of polymer blends for industrial items such as floor coverings, composite lumber, or injection-molded items that endure mixed polymer residential or commercial properties. The worth per kilogram is not high compared to virgin polymers, however the worth to a plant originates from prevented disposal expenses, ESG gains, and sometimes, engagement in take-back programs that supply rebates or credits.

Hybrid versions are ending up being a lot more usual. For example, a center could launder recyclable cut handwear covers made use of in setting up, while sending out non reusable nitrile gloves from product packaging areas to a specialized recycler. The approach below is to take full advantage of the recuperated portion without compromising any line's hygiene or safety and security needs.

The situation for starting small and measuring like a hawk

The fastest way to eliminate a round program is to scale a poor presumption. The 2nd fastest is to avoid the math. Pilot jobs, done with a prejudice for data, protect you from both.

A pilot has 3 work. Initially, show that the program does not threaten safety or top quality. Second, prove that it matches the day-to-day rhythm of procedures with very little rubbing. Third, capture clean information so the ROI calculator informs a trustworthy story.

That calculator must not be window dressing. It must mirror your realities, not a vendor's standard. Glove prices vary by area and by polymer. Disposal costs swing by location and by the nature of your waste contract. Labor time for collection and sorting looks different in a lean plant versus a stretching site. So, develop the calculator to handle varieties and circumstances. You want to see what occurs if handwear cover rates climb 15 percent or if haul-away costs rise after an agreement renewal. You intend to see the effect of contamination rates on the return of recyclable product. If your lawful team restricts recycling of any kind of product from a sterilized zone, the calculator ought to understand that too.

A common pilot may target a single high-volume division for eight to twelve weeks. Baseline your glove intake, waste weights, contamination prices in containers, and near-miss reports related to PPE modifications. Train operators with basic visual hints and a few minutes of context regarding why the program exists. Then watch. Walk the flooring. Ask managers what creates rubbing. Check the bins for mis-sorts and foreign products. Readjust your container placement, labels, and pickups. The little tweaks below are gold. Relocating a container 10 feet can raise capture rates by dual digits.

Compliance and the danger conversation

Circularity without conformity is an obligation. Your EHS and QA groups must co-own the program with operations. They will flag circumstances where recycling is not permitted, regardless of how compelling it looks on paper. Biological dangers, solvent direct exposure, or heavy steels can disqualify whole waste streams from glove recycling. The response is not to push past those red lines. It is to map them and develop the program around what is absolutely risk-free and compliant.

Documentation is your buddy. Standard procedure for collection, signs that matches SOP language, and training documents all minimize rubbing with auditors. If you operate under GFSI plans in food, or under ISO 13485 in medical devices, straighten your program documents to those frameworks. The initiative pays off when your auditor asks how you control the threat of reintroducing polluted materials and you can show a circulation layout that ends at a recycler, not back on the line.

Common pitfalls and just how to avoid them

The most common failure mode is overcomplication. More bins do not equivalent more circularity. If your system needs operators to select amongst five streams for PPE gloves, you will certainly get noise, not signal. Keep it basic till habits is ingrained.

The second risk is treating the program as an one-time launch rather than a managed process. Personnel turnover, line modifications, and seasonality will wear down efficiency unless a person possesses maintenance. Light-touch governance works: a quarterly testimonial, fast refreshers throughout onboarding, and regular audits of container contents.

Third, mismatch in between messaging and truth. If you tell individuals every handwear cover obtains become a shiny brand-new product and then they see denied bins getting landfilled, trust fund collapses. Establish assumptions honestly. Explain contamination limits and why some product does not make the cut. Many drivers obtain it. They value being treated like adults.

Finally, overlooking the upstream procurement bar wastes utilize. If your firm acquires ten different handwear cover SKUs that do basically the same task, combination can increase your reusing program's purity and minimize procurement spin. Line up vendors with your circular goals. Some will adapt, others will not. The marketplace has space for those that do.
